Title :
Weak-strong simulation of beam-photoelectron instability in a positron storage ring

Abstract :
Growth of the photoelectron instability has been discussed by using a wake force occurred by electron cloud. Concept of the conventional wake force is available for the force which satisfies linearity and superposition for the coherent amplitude of bunches. Weak-strong simulation method for beam-photoelectron interactions is proposed to study the nonlinear wake effect. In the method, photoelectrons are expressed by macro-particles and the beam by a series of rigid Gaussian bunch. We can investigate by the method not only nonlinear wake effect but also instability for a bunch train and an arbitrary bunch filling
